gradient

ELLIE RUSSELL

Stacyc Brushless Open fs, Stacyc 5 & Up fs, Stacyc Brushless Open, Stacyc 5 & Up

25 races. 9 podiums. 3 wins.

Last Finish: 8th
Brushless Open
Texas Winter Series Stacyc Rd 4
0

headlingRider's Race Results